The Wichita Eagle newspaper is putting the finishing touches on an overhaul of its business section, according to an item posted on the paper’s Web site.
The story read, “We are very busy here planning our first edition, which will hit the streets Sept. 7. We also are busy with the marketing campaign for our new business section, which will hit another gear on Wednesday.
“Another bit of news: We are putting the finishing touches on being able to deliver our morning business updates directly to your computer’s inbox. Right now, you have to log on to Kansas.com to get our update, which we post every morning at 11:30. Pretty soon, the latest breaking business news — plus a look at what’s coming up in the next day’s paper — will be just a click away.
“We’ll post details on how to sign up in the paper and at Kansas.com and eaglebusinesstoday.com.”
